Peeps in flightby kreshkinComment by kreshkin: I threaded the sugary beasts onto white thread, then attached several strings of them to a stick (sort of like for controlling marionettes). I think they might look more, er, natural if the threads were tied together and anchored to the ground, rather than being on parallel vertical strings.
Of course I had to clone out the threads, which were surprisingly visible (I always thought white thread was supposed to be great for making things look like they were floating in the air).
I staged a couple other shots too.
